NEW OUTREACH PROVOST UC Riverside has named Pamela Clute, a mathematics and science specialist widely recognized for her work with K-12 students and teachers, as assistant vice provost for Academic Outreach and Educational Partnerships. Clute will coordinate and support campus-wide outreach activities that will include K-12 schools, community college transfers and graduate outreach initiatives. FREE HEARING SCREENING The Casa Colina Audiology Center has begun a free hearing screening program on the first Monday of every month, from 3-6 p.m. Children, young adults and the elderly are welcome to be have their hearing screened and evaluated at no charge. Each screening takes about 10 minutes and is done by appointment only. All participants will receive a copy of their screening and the audiologist’s recommendations. Casa Colina is located at 255 E. Bonita Ave. in Pomona. Information: 909.450.0304. COUNTY SPELLING BEE The best young spellers from schools all over Riverside County are gathering at Martin Luther King High School on March 15 for the 2005 Riverside County Spelling Bee. The competition begins at 9:30 a.m. and the awards ceremony concludes at 2 p.m. The winners will represent Riverside County at the State Spelling Bee to be held in May at Sonoma State University. Martin Luther King High School is located at 9301 Wood Road in Riverside. Information: 951.826.6570.
